Stackable Medium Container LP-STM-1609 – 1000×600×94 mm
Reference: LP-STM-1609
- External dimensions: 1000 × 600 × 94 mm
- Internal usable footprint: 943 × 543 mm
- Internal height: 70 mm
- Usable volume: 36 litres
- Tare weight: 4.20 kg
- Maximum load: 20 kg
- Stack load: 250 kg
- Material options: PP-C (polypropylene copolymer) or ESD conductive black
- Base design: rhombic reinforced base for high rigidity and quiet conveyor movement
- Features: smooth stacking rim, internal grid for inserts/dunnage, marking areas for RFID or barcode labels
- Daimler references: T5 30714 (PPC standard) | T5 33714 (ESD conductive)

The LP-STM-1609 is a low-profile 1000×600 mm stackable plastic container engineered for maximum surface utilization and stability in palletized and automated logistics systems. With a 94 mm total height, this model is ideal for shallow components or assemblies that require broad surface protection with minimal vertical space — perfect for optimizing truck load height and storage density in automotive and industrial supply chains.
The reinforced rhombic base ensures rigidity and quiet operation on conveyors, lifters, and automated ASRS or AKL systems, while the smooth stacking rim enables secure, vibration-free stacking. Designed for the ISO pallet format (1200×1000 mm), two LP-STM-1609 containers form a complete pallet layer, allowing perfect modular integration with other 600×500 or 400×300 containers within the same logistics cycle.
Manufactured in PP-C for general industrial use or ESD conductive black for electrostatic-sensitive components, the LP-STM-1609 is used extensively in automotive logistics by OEMs such as Daimler, where it supports both manual and robotic material handling. Its compact height and wide footprint make it a top choice for precision mechanical parts, electronic modules, or small housings requiring safe and efficient storage.
When produced with UN certification, it can also carry safety components such as airbag igniters or pyrotechnic subassemblies classified under UN 3268.
